Definition | A fast-sampling, fully integrated CTD package for use in environmental monitoring, fisheries, ocean observing networks and other marine applications. It measures condutivity and temperature with depth and utilises the patented Non-eXternal Inductive Cell (NXIC) conductivity sensor. The CTD-NH exhibits a bio-fouling resistant design, and the NXIC internal conductivity cells do not suffer from proximity effects, allowing it to be mounted in any orientation close to other instruments. The CTD-NH offers optional datalogging and external analog sensor input, and can run for 400 hours on its internal 3V battery pack. It is depth rated to 500 m. | |
